Is it worth the money...
I have been a looker on this board for a while now. I have a 2002 TLs with a few mods. I am looking right now at the SC and the big brake kit for my car. My question to everyone is if you have the money would you get the SC and brake kit or would you spend a little more and trade your car in for something better. My wife tells me I should stop spending money on my car and trade up for something I don't have to mess with so much.

yeah, do the math on the parts alone... then add the labor (unless you know how to do all that stuff yourself), that's alot of $$$. Then look at other things like your credit... can you get another car with good interest (with the money you were going to spend on the SC and Brakes as down payment)? You might be better off going that route. Then again, if you were to "upgrade" on a car... your insurance might go up too. You gotta keep all those things in mind... (I'm sure there are a least half a dozen more things to consider). Someone else posted this before in another tread re: SC, it hasn't been out long enough to see if it'll cause "problems" , like... can our tranny handle it in the long run etc. etc...?

The s/c in my opinion IS worth every bit of the money. It is from a tried and true company. You get great gains for a FWD vehicle, but the gains are mostly utilized on the highway. The car will be quicker than a G35 or MB320/430 (moderately slower than a C32), more reliable than a BMW M3 but slower, quicker than the BMW 5 series, etc, etc...
Reliability is Comptech's key feature: your car should run smoothly for 100k miles without messing with the blower. That is worth every bit of $4,000. In the long run, that isn't bad especially when considering your TL-S was less than $31k to begin with...
